What Does “Massage Erotiche” Actually Mean?

The phrase massage erotiche is Italian and is generally translated to “erotic massage.” However, the modern usage goes beyond literal translation. In online discussions and wellness contexts, the term touches on several themes:

  • Sensual relaxation

  • Human touch and emotional comfort

  • Stress relief

  • Psychological intimacy

  • Cultural understandings of touch

While some people perceive it purely in a sexual context, others view it through a more holistic lens—connecting it to emotional healing, body awareness, and therapeutic touch.

It is important to clarify that professional therapists and licensed wellness practitioners follow strict ethical guidelines, and they do not provide erotic or sexual services. Instead, any discussion around massage erotiche must be handled with awareness of boundaries, legality, and professional standards.

Touch as Therapy: The Healthy Side Behind the Concept

Even though masajes eroticos it self is not part of professional therapy, the concept of touch has real scientific and emotional significance.

1. Touch Reduces Anxiety

Simple, non-sexual forms of physical touch—like hand massages or back rubs—lower stress and improve mood.

2. Enhances Emotional Connection

In relationships, partners sometimes use gentle massage to build trust and emotional closeness.

3. Improves Body Awareness

For many people, understanding how their body responds to touch helps boost:

  • confidence

  • self-esteem

  • relaxation

  • mindfulness

4. Encourages Relaxation and Sleep

Soothing touch activates the parasympathetic nervous system, helping the body unwind.
